#1fe2e5 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#1fe2e5 is composed of 12.2% red, 88.6% green and 89.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.5% cyan, 1.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 180.9 degrees, a saturation of 79.2% and a lightness of 51%. #1fe2e5 color hex could be obtained by blending #3effff with #00c5cb. Closest websafe color is: #33cccc.

● #1fe2e5 color description : Vivid cyan.
The hexadecimal color #1fe2e5 has RGB values of R:31, G:226, B:229 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0.01, Y:0,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 2089701.
